CORE D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:

As a Credit Specialist in our Creditor Practice, you will:

  • Analyze borrower data
  • Communicate with borrowers on behalf of major banks and financial institutions, using various channels such as inbound/outbound calls, email, and text messages
  • Manage deadlines and prioritize files based on the rate of recovery
  • Review debt recovery processes
  • Ensure file accuracy
  • Coordinate all client and lawyer reporting requirements
